McFeeley Strong Story

McFeeley Strong Story

Brian McFeeley, Mt. Lebanon High School Principal, was just recently diagnosed with stage 4 pancreatic cancer. At this time it’s inoperable because it has spread to his liver. He plans to do everything possible to fight the cancer and has begun chemotherapy treatments. This site was created to support Brian, his wife Keary, and their two boys Colin (14 years old) and Adam (13 years old). County Republicans Pick DeMarco As New Chair

County Republicans Pick DeMarco As New Chair
“The status quo is going to change,” said DeMarco shortly after being named the new chair of the Republican Committee of Allegheny County. “I ran for this seat because what was happening was unacceptable. The sole mission of the county party is to field candidates for local office, and we have been a dismal failure. That needed to stop.”
